The Hippies & Cowboys Podcast will bring you conversation about everything within the world of country music. Each episode will feature fresh tunes from artists that are keeping the true sound and substance of the genre alive. Frequently Asked Questions About Hippies & Cowboys Podcast

What is Hippies & Cowboys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show focuses on country and roots music through candid conversations with both rising and established artists, exploring creative processes, touring life, and the shifting landscape of independent and traditional country. Episodes frequently cover recording stories, backstage dynamics, and how artists balance craft with business, often highlighting regional scenes (Texas/Red Dirt, Appalachia) and cross-border perspectives. Noteworthy is the emphasis on authentic storytelling, live performance culture, and the artists' journeys from indie roots to larger stages, making it a solid pick for listeners who love deep-dive artist chats and fresh music recommendations.
